zkt25/z2/service.yaml

43 lines
648 B
YAML

apiVersion: v1
kind: Service
metadata:
name: flask-service
namespace: userapp
spec:
selector:
app: flask-app
type: NodePort
ports:
- protocol: TCP
port: 5000
targetPort: 5000
nodePort: 30001
---
apiVersion: v1
kind: Service
metadata:
name: postgres-service
namespace: userapp
spec:
selector:
app: postgres
ports:
- protocol: TCP
port: 5432
targetPort: 5432
---
apiVersion: v1
kind: Service
metadata:
name: pgadmin-service
namespace: userapp
spec:
selector:
app: pgadmin
type: NodePort
ports:
- protocol: TCP
port: 80
targetPort: 80
nodePort: 30002